教程目录 一 protobuf简介 二 使用protobuf 三 Demo下载参考:TS项目中使用Protobuf的解决方案(babel)在cocos creator中使用protobufjslayabox:网络和格式--ProtocolBufferegret protobuf(egret官方提供的工具,自动配置和生成) protobuf简介 百度百科:protocolbuffer(以下简称PB)
## 实现“android接口 协议 protobuf”的流程
### 步骤表格
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 准备protobuf文件 |
| 2 | 生成Java类 |
| 3 | 集成protobuf库到Android项目 |
| 4 | 编写代码使用protobuf |
### 详细步骤
1. **准备protobuf文件**
在项目中
原创
2024-03-03 04:29:38
48阅读
简介:Google Protocol Buffer(简称Protobuf)是google公司内部的混合语言数据标准,目前已经正在使用的有超过48,162种报文格式定义和超过12183个.proto文件。他们用于RPC系统和持续数据存储系统。Protocol Buffers是一种轻便高效的结构化数据存储格式,可以用于结构化数据串行化,或者说序列化。他很适合做数据存储或RPC数据交换格式。可用于通讯协
转载
2023-08-21 19:32:14
98阅读
最近做功能需要用到使用UDP协议和服务器进行通信,之前没有接触这一块,所以花了些时间了解和实现,这里做一下记录和分享。首先我们要知道UDP通信协议是Socket通信的一种实现方式,Socket通信一般有两种通信方式:基于TCP协议、基于UDP协议。这两者的差别和优缺点就不说了,这里主要讲一下基于UDP协议的实现。基本原理基于UDP的通信都是通过java.net.DatagramSocket这个类来
转载
2023-07-26 05:41:10
104阅读
Socket编程是一种网络编程技术,可以实现计算机之间的通信。FTP(文件传输协议)是一种用于在网络上传输文件的协议。而Linux则是一种流行的操作系统,被广泛用于服务器和网络设备中。在Linux系统中,通过使用Socket编程实现FTP协议是一种常见的做法。
使用Socket编程实现FTP协议可以让用户在Linux系统中方便地进行文件传输。通过FTP协议,用户可以上传和下载文件,管理远程文件
原创
2024-03-26 10:00:33
78阅读
android的网络编程分为2种:基于socket的,和基于http协议的。
基于socket的用法
服务器端:
先启动一个服务器端的socket ServerSocket svr = new ServerSocket(8989);
开始侦听请求 Socket s = svr.accept();
取得输入和输出 D
转载
精选
2012-06-28 10:06:15
717阅读
## 从零开始学习使用protobuf协议
欢迎来到本篇文章,如果你是一名刚入行的开发者,并且对protobuf协议还不太了解,那么你来对地方了!我们将一步步地介绍如何使用protobuf协议,希望能够帮助你快速上手。
### 什么是protobuf协议?
Protobuf是一种轻量级的数据交换格式,它可以用来定义数据结构、序列化和反序列化数据。在Kubernetes这样的大型系统中,使用p
原创
2024-05-16 10:43:25
84阅读
微信蓝牙调试工具:https://iot.weixin.qq.com/wiki/document-0_5.html 可以解析微信协议,并且知道设备哪个字段赋值了,哪个字段没有赋值。理解protobuf之前必须要懂variant编码 !!!!!!!!!!varian编码 :http://bl
原创
2017-10-30 09:16:47
2908阅读
Socket(套接字)是一种通信机制,可以实现单机或跨网络进行通信,其创建需要明确的区分C(客户端)/S(服务器端),支持多个客户端连接到同一个服务器。有两种传输模式:1)、面向连接的传输:基于TCP协议,可靠性高,但效率低;2)、面向无连接的传输:基于UDP协议,可靠性低,但效率高; &n
转载
2023-11-21 23:25:39
134阅读
一、socket通信简介android与服务器的通信方式主要有两种,一是http通信,一是socket通信。两者的最大差异在于,http连接使用的是“请求—响应方式”,即在请求时建立连接通道,当客户端向服务器发送请求后,服务器端才能向客户端返回数据。而socket通信则是在双方建立起连接后就可以直接进行数据的传输,在连接时可实现信息的主动推送,而不需要每次由客户端想服务器发送请求。 那么,什么是s
转载
2023-07-26 20:40:37
56阅读
Android端 - 通过Socket以及TCP协议和MFC端通信(Receive篇)前言PC端Android端注意 前言上一篇 Android端 - 通过Socket以及TCP协议和MFC端通信(Send篇); 中说到,接到一功能要求,Android 端实现在 WIFI 局域网的条件下和 PC 端通信;上一篇实现了手机端 发送;本文将实现 手机端接收文件!PC端发送文件信息:MD5$fileN
转载
2024-07-30 21:31:20
49阅读
首先明确一下概念,WebSocket协议是一种建立在TCP连接基础上的全双工通信的协议。概念强调了两点内容:TCP基础上全双工通信那么什么是全双工通信呢?全双工就是指客户端和服务端可以同时进行双向通信,强调同时、双向通信WebSocket可以应用于即时通信等场景,比如现在直播很火热,直播中的弹幕也可以使用WebSocket去实现。WebSocket的协议内容可以见 The WebSocket Pr
转载
2023-12-30 20:50:21
130阅读
1. 使用基于TCP协议的Socket一个客户端要发起一次通信,首先必须知道运行服务器端的主机IP地址。然后由网络基础设施利用目标地址,将客户端发送的信息传递到正确的主机上,在Java中,地址可以由一个字符串来定义,这个字符串可以使数字型的地址(比如192.168.1.1),也可以是主机名(e
转载
2024-06-21 12:24:49
34阅读
一、Socket通信简介 Android与服务器的通信方式主要有两种,一是Http通信,一是Socket通信。两者的最大差异在于,http连接使用的是“请求—响应方式”,即在请求时建立连接通道,当客户端向服务器发送请求后,服务器端才能向客户端返回数据。而Socket通信则是在双方建立起连接后就可以直接进行数据的传输,在连接时可实现信息的主动推送,而不需要每次由客户端想服务器发送请求。 那
转载
2023-07-12 01:05:01
96阅读
1、通信简介安卓与服务端的通信方式主要有两种,一种是 Http 通信,一种是 Socket 通信。Socket 属于传输层,因为 TCP/IP 协议属于传输层,解决的是数据如何在网络中传输的问题Http 协议属于应用层,解决的是如何包装数据两者最大的差异,就是工作方式的不同:Http:采用 请求—响应 方式1、即建立网络连接后,当 客户端 向 服务器 发送请求后,服务端才能向客户端返回数据 2、可
转载
2023-07-26 05:41:34
207阅读
网络编程的一些介绍目前较为流行的网络编程模型是客户机/服务器(C/S)结构。即通信双方一方作为服务器等待客户提出请求并予以响应。客户则在需要服务时向服务器提 出申请。服务器一般作为守护进程始终运行,监听网络端口,一旦有客户请求,就会启动一个服务进程来响应该客户,同时自己继续监听服务端口,使后来的客户也 能及时得到服务。 TCP是Tranfer Control Protocol的 简称,是
转载
2023-07-10 10:49:37
0阅读
最近公司要做一款内部使用的工具类app,方便销售部门打电话(其实就是在后台有好多用户数据,之前销售部门同事拨打电话,需要自己从销售后台查看用户手机号等信息,然后自己拿自己手机拨号,然后打出去。现在想实现销售的同事,点击销售后台的按钮,自己的手机直接拨号的功能)。为此,开始着手思考,怎么实现销售后台点击按钮,手机app端能收到点击按钮的监听。 首先,后台提供一个
转载
2023-07-03 19:03:43
207阅读
https://blog.csdn.net/ding3106/article/details/80714410private static ExecutorService mExecuto
原创
2022-05-26 17:09:36
75阅读
一. 套接字(socket) socket英文为插座的意思,也就是为用户提供了一个接入某个链路的接口。而在计算机网络中,一个IP地址标识唯一一台主机,而一个端口号标识着主机中唯一一个应用进程,因此“IP+端口号”就可以称之为socket。 两个主机的进程之间要通信,就可以各自建立一个socket,其实可以看做各自提供出来一个“插座”,然后通过连接
原创
精选
2016-05-20 22:19:02
3158阅读
点赞
1评论
一. socket API 前面一篇《基于TCP协议之——socket编程》http://2627lounuo.blog.51cto.com/10696599/1775559已经花了大量的篇幅讲述了socket和使用基本的socket API所需要注意的问题,这里就不再赘述了。下面主要谈论的是UDP和TCP在socket编程中的不同之处;1. 创建sock &
原创
2016-05-22 19:38:17
3264阅读